Bridget Harris
Director of Operations
Bridget is an accomplished operations leader with extensive experience driving organisational effectiveness, operational excellence, and strategic business support across international organisations. As Director of Operations at Epidarex, she leads the firm’s global operations and business support functions, with a focus on developing scalable processes, strengthening organisational infrastructure, and implementing innovative strategies that enhance performance.
Bridget brings more than 16 years of experience spanning venture capital, land promotion, recruitment, and the arts sector. Her expertise includes business operations, process improvement, and stakeholder management, with a strong track record of delivering strategic initiatives and supporting business growth. Prior to joining Epidarex, she held operational roles including Office Manager at Wallace Land Investments and Operations Lead at Hudson, a global talent solutions business operating across approximately 20 countries.
Bridget maintains a strong interest in the arts and creative sector. During her time in Australia, she worked for the Australian Performing Arts Collection (APAC) in collection development and stakeholder management, and contributed to the delivery of major public art commissions as part of the Victorian Government’s redevelopment of Melbourne’s iconic Hamer Hall.
Bridget holds a Master of Art Curatorship from the University of Melbourne and a Bachelor of Fine Art from Otago Polytechnic, New Zealand. She is also Vice President of the New Zealand Society Scotland, helping to foster connections within the New Zealand community across Scotland.
